Low trucks
* Better fuel efficiency: Low trucks are more aerodynamic than high trucks, which can help to improve fuel efficiency. This is important for trucks that are used for long-haul transportation or other applications where fuel economy is a concern.
* Improved handling: Low trucks have a lower center of gravity than high trucks, which makes them more stable and easier to handle. This is important for trucks that are used in urban areas or other congested environments where maneuverability is important.
* Reduced wind resistance: Low trucks have less wind resistance than high trucks, which can help to reduce drag and improve performance. This is important for trucks that are used for racing or other high-performance applications.
